Título 14. CORPORATIONS, PARTNERSHIPS, AND ASSOCIATIONS · Capítulo 8. PARTNERSHIPS
14-8-38.1. Vesting of property of dissolved partnership in partnership continuing business.

When a partnership is dissolved for any reason, either pursuant to the provisions of this chapter or the partnership agreement or otherwise, and the business is continued as a partnership, the title to any real property or other property vested in such dissolved partnership shall, by operation of law, be vested in the partnership continuing the business without reversion or impairment and without further act or deed or other instrument of transfer or conveyance.
History
Code 1981, § 14-8-38.1, enacted by Ga. L. 1989, p. 927, § 3.
Law reviews
For note on 1989 enactment of this Code section, see 6 Ga. St. U. L. Rev. 188 (1989).
